1. An alien starship is 0.20 lightyears from Earth and traveling at 0.70c, as observed from Earth. This ship sends out a smaller scout ship to see if the inhabitants of Earth are friendly. This scout ship travels at 0.90c as seen from the starship and has a mass of 350,000 kg. a) Determine the velocity of the scout ship as seen from an observer on Earth. b) At the time of the launch of the scout ship, what is the distance to Earth as measured by the aliens abroad the main ship, and c) and the scout ship?. d) Find the time it takes the scout ship to get to Earth as seen by both Earth and main ship observers. e) What is the kinetic energy of scout ship from the reference frame of the Earth?
